① 請教EXCEL中if的應用
Excel是我們工作中很常用的表格製作工具,它不僅僅只是用來製作表格,還能幫助我們處理數據(比如:運算、篩選、排序等等)。我給大家介紹excel if函數的詳細用法,希望對大家有所幫助!
excel if函數
一、excel if函數基本用法
在excel表格中,如果我們學會使用excel if函數來處理數據的話,可以提高我們的工作效率。接下來我們一起來學習excel if函數的基本用法吧!
1、excel if函數語法格式:=IF(條件,值1,值2)
語法格式說明:
IF括弧中的逗號是英文下的逗號;
當條件滿足時,則返回值1;當條件不滿足時,則返回值2;
值2可以省略,省略後返回值由FALSE代替。
2、實例
為了演示,小編提前准備了一張表格,如下所示:
excel if函數用法1
實例的內容:使用excel if函數將是否合格一列的數據補充完整(大於或等於60分的為合格,其它的為不合格)。
操作步驟:將滑鼠游標放在是否合格單元格下的空單元格->在fx後的輸入框中輸入「=IF(E2>=60,"合格","不合格")」並按回車鍵(Enter鍵)->將滑鼠游標放在該單元格的右下角往下拉即可。具體操作如下:
excel if函數用法2
二、excel if函數嵌套用法
excel if函數嵌套用法也很簡單,和基本用法差不多,只是多了一層或多層IF函數而已。接下來我們一起來看看學習吧!
1、excel if函數語法格式:
IF(條件1,值1,IF(條件2,值2,值3))
語法格式說明:
IF括弧中的逗號是英文下的逗號;
當滿足條件1時,則返回值1;當不滿足條件1時,判斷條件2,如果滿足條件2,則返回值2,否則返回值3;
excel if函數嵌套還可以多成嵌套。
2、實例
實例內容:將成績是否合格一列補充完整(小於60分的為不合格,大於或等於80分的優秀,其餘的為合格)。
操作步驟和上邊基本用法的操作一樣,只是在fx後輸入框中輸入的函數不一樣,應該輸入的是:「=IF(E2<60,"不合格",IF(E2>=80,"優秀","合格"))」。如下圖所示:
excel if函數用法3
好了,關於excel if函數的詳細教程(基本用法和嵌套用法)就到此結束了,希望能幫助大家!
② if函數的使用方法及實例
if函數使用:
IF(logical_test,value_if_true,value_if_false)
if函數根據指定的條件來判斷其「真」(TRUE)、「假」(FALSE),根據邏輯計算的真假值,從而返回相應的內容。可以使用函數 IF 對數值和公式進行條件檢測。
實例:
(1)IF(A2<=100,"Withinbudget","Overbudget"),
說明:如果上面的數字小於等於100,則公式將顯示「Withinbudget」。否則,公式顯示「Overbudget」。
結果:Withinbudget。
(2)IF(A2=100,SUM(B2:B5),"")
說明:如果上面數字為100,則計算單元格區域B2:B5之和,否則返回空文本。
結果:" "
(2)excelif的使用方法及實例擴展閱讀:
IF函數的參數:
(1)Logical_test 表示計算結果為 TRUE 或 FALSE 的任意值或表達式。
例如,A10=100 就是一個邏輯表達式,如果單元格 A10 中的值等於 100,表達式即為 TRUE,否則為 FALSE。本參數可使用任何比較運算符(=(等於)、>(大於)、>=(大於等於)、<=(小於等於等運算符))。
(2)Value_if_true表示 logical_test 為 TRUE 時返回的值。
例如,如果本參數為文本字元串「預算內」而且
logical_test 參數值為 TRUE,則 IF 函數將顯示文本「預算內」。如果 logical_test 為 TRUE 而
value_if_true 為空,則本參數返回 0。
(3)Value_if_false表示 logical_test 為 FALSE 時返回的值。
例如,如果本參數為文本字元串「超出預算」而且
logical_test 參數值為 FALSE,則 IF 函數將顯示文本「超出預算」。如果 logical_test 為 FALSE 且忽略了
value_if_false(即 value_if_true 後沒有逗號)。
參考資料來源:網路—IF函數
③ EXCEL里的IF函數具體怎麼使用最好舉個例子
▲在「成績表」工作表中,在「等級」欄位下用粘貼函數的if函數將「英語」成績小於60分的用「不及格」表示;60~89分的用「合格」表示;大於等於90分的用「優秀」表示。
▼=IF(E7>=90,"優秀",IF(AND(E7>=60,E7<90),"合格",IF(E7<60,"不及格")))
■高中同學遇到了一個在excel中的函數問題,我們探討了一下,感覺還可以,基本上可以實現目前想要的結果,就是在excel中把兩列的數值進行對應,輸入一個值就出來另外一個數值.這樣的問題可以用if函數來解決的,通過if函數自然就可以看到結果.不過這樣的if最多就7個,不能滿足需要,我覺得通過計算機其他語言的學習,我完全可以用case語句,如果case語句用不了,不知道還能用什麼語句了.
D2小於等於50,D3小於等於1800便為"合格"反之為:"不合格",公式應該是輸入?
=if(and(d2<=50,d3<=1800),"合格","不合格")
在B1單元格編輯公式
=IF(A1>=500,"一級",IF(AND(A1>=450,A1<500),"二級","三級"))
回車確認即可。
可以用填充柄把B1中的公式向下復制到相應的單元格。
就這些語句就足夠了.
只要掌握了他的語句格式,和他的語法,基本上就可以解決的.不過excel中應該還有很多其他的功能和演算法需要研究.
□在Excel中If函數的使用方法http://..com/question/15517131.html
http://hi..com/qdike/blog/item/6f639f58c48be7de9c8204cb.html
回答眼鏡小熊的問題:我在學校里做成績單,老班要求每一個人列出自己的追趕目標是誰,為了在成績單里體現每個同學的追趕成功與否,要把同學本人的成績與被追趕同學的成績加以比較,再返回Yes或No。可是用手工一個個向單元格里製造函數太累了,誰能幫我想個一勞永逸的辦法?
增加K列,顯示追趕成功與否的結果(如上圖所示),在K4中輸入公式:
=IF(ISNA(MATCH(J4,$B$4:$B$9,0)),"",IF(H4<INDEX($B$4:$H$9,MATCH(J4,$B$4:$B$9,0),7),"NO","Yes"))
1、確定要統計的數據區域。這里只是統計第4行到第九行的數據。如果你們班同學的數據到了第40行,就把公式中相應的$B$9、$H$9改成$B$40、$H$40,即:
=IF(ISNA(MATCH(J4,$B$4:$B$40,0)),"",IF(H4<INDEX($B$4:$H$40,MATCH(J4,$B$4:$B$40,0),7),"NO","Yes"))
2、把此公式一直向下復制到列表最後。即達到你要的結果。
3、關於該公式的解釋:根據某同學的追逐目標,在「姓名」里找到目標同學的姓名,MATCH(J4,$B$4:$B$40,0),7);再找到目標同學對應的總分成績INDEX($B$4:$H$40,MATCH(J4,$B$4:$B$40,0),7);判斷,如果該同學總分小於目標同學總分,顯示"NO",否則,顯示"Yes",IF(H4<INDEX($B$4:$H$40,MATCH(J4,$B$4:$B$40,0),7),"NO","Yes");如果找不到目標同學的姓名,就顯示空白。
□誰知道在Excel中If函數的使用方法?
我在學校里做成績單,老班要求每一個人列出自己的追趕目標是誰,為了在成績單里體現每個同學的追趕成功與否,要把同學本人的成績與被追趕同學的成績加以比較,再返回Yes或No。可是用手工一個個向單元格里製造函數太累了,誰能幫我想個一勞永逸的辦法?
□最佳答案□
增加K列,顯示追趕成功與否的結果,在K4中輸入公式:
=IF(ISNA(MATCH(J4,$B$4:$B$9,0)),"",IF(H4<INDEX($B$4:$H$9,MATCH(J4,$B$4:$B$9,0),7),"NO","Yes"))
1、確定要統計的數據區域。這里只是統計第4行到第九行的數據。如果你們班同學的數據到了第40行,就把公式中相應的$B$9、$H$9改成$B$40、$H$40,即:
=IF(ISNA(MATCH(J4,$B$4:$B$40,0)),"",IF(H4<INDEX($B$4:$H$40,MATCH(J4,$B$4:$B$40,0),7),"NO","Yes"))
2、把此公式一直向下復制到列表最後。即達到你要的結果。
3、關於該公式的解釋:根據某同學的追逐目標,在「姓名」里找到目標同學的姓名,MATCH(J4,$B$4:$B$40,0),7);再找到目標同學對應的總分成績INDEX($B$4:$H$40,MATCH(J4,$B$4:$B$40,0),7);判斷,如果該同學總分小於目標同學總分,顯示"NO",否則,顯示"Yes",IF(H4<INDEX($B$4:$H$40,MATCH(J4,$B$4:$B$40,0),7),"NO","Yes");如果找不到目標同學的姓名,就顯示空白。
④ excel if函數使用教程,詳細一些,最好有實例。
Excel中If函數的用法為=If(結果為True或Flase的條件,結果為True時返回的值,結果為False時返回的值),往往在實際應用中需要在If函數中再嵌套一個甚至多個If函數。
軟體版本:Office2007
If函數用法舉例說明:
1.根據A列數值范圍,在B列中返回內容
A列數值小於60,B返回「不合格」
A列數值大於等於60,小於80,返回「一般」
A列數值大於等於80,小於90,返回「良好」
A列數值大於等於90,返回「優秀」
⑤ Excel中的If函數具體怎麼使用
你提供的那個公式羅玉虎已給出正確回答.
if函數是根據指定的條件來判斷其「真」(true)、「假」false),從而返回相對應的內容。(if函數可以嵌套七層)
語法形式:if(logical_test,value_if_true,value_if_false)
logical_test:表示邏輯判決表達式;
value_if_true:表示當判斷條件為邏輯值「真」(true)時,顯示該處給定的內容;
value_if_false:表示當判斷條件為邏輯值「假」(false)時,顯示該處給定的內容。
實例:若要通過每期考核的平均成績來評定員工是否達標,可以使用if函數來實現。在f2中的公式為「=if(e2>=60,"達標","未達標"),表示如果平均成績達到60以上,顯示為「達標」,反之,顯示為「未達標」。
⑥ excel函數if的用法
-
函數名稱:IF
-
主要功能:根據對指定條件的邏輯判斷的真假結果,返回相對應的內容。
-
使用格式:=IF(Logical,Value_if_true,Value_if_false)
-
參數說明:Logical代表邏輯判斷表達式;Value_if_true表示當判斷條件為邏輯「真(TRUE)」時的顯示內容,如果忽略返回「TRUE」;Value_if_false表示當判斷條件為邏輯「假(FALSE)」時的顯示內容,如果忽略返回「FALSE」。
應用舉例:
例1、在C29單元格中輸入公式:=IF(C26>=18,"符合要求","不符合要求"),確信以後,如果C26單元格中的數值大於或等於18,則C29單元格顯示「符合要求」字樣,反之顯示「不符合要求」字樣。
例2、如果想要實現」假如A1大於等於100,則A2=100;假如A1小於100,則A2等於A1「
操作:在A中2輸入
=IF(A1>=100,100,A1)
⑦ EXCEL中IF的用法
1、返回如花的銷售額
=SUMIF(B:B,」如花」,C:C)
2、返回除了如花之外的銷售額
=SUMIF(B:B,」<>如花」,C:C)
3、返回大於900的銷售額
=SUMIF(C:C,」>900″)
12、返回如花和秋花的銷售總額
=SUM(SUMIF(B:B,{「如花」,」秋花」},C:C))
13、返回每個人最後一次考核分數的平均分
=SUMIF(B3:F10,」」,B2:F9)/5
條件和求和區域錯行引用,求和條件為」」,需要好好理解
14、返回如花的銷售總額
=SUMIF(B:E,」如花」,C:F)
條件和求和區域錯列引用。如果B:E列等於求和條件「如花」,則對C:F求和。
⑧ 在excel表格中如何用if函數
if函數是一個判斷函數,也就是說你已經有一個條件根據你這個條件去判斷是否符合。如果符合的話,返回一個值,如果不符合的話,返回另一個值,這是對這個函數的定義。那麼下面下面我將說一下如何使用,然後在一個單元格裡面輸入=if,然後括弧,括弧裡面第一個就是判斷語錄,然後輸入英文狀態下的逗號,下面輸入判斷正確的返回值,然後再輸入一個英文狀態下的逗號,接著輸入判斷錯誤的時候返回值,這就是整個一函數的使用全部過程。